public function miseEnSessionUtilisateur(Personnel $personnel, $motDePasse) { $utilisateur = new Container('utilisateur'); $utilisateur->offsetSet('id', $personnel->getId()); $utilisateur->offsetSet('admin', $personnel->getAdministrateur()); $utilisateur->offsetSet('identite', $personnel->getPrenom() . ' ' . $personnel->getNom()); $utilisateur->offsetSet('email', $personnel->getEmail()); $utilisateur->offsetSet('mot_de_passe', $motDePasse); // Hum... Réccupérer le mot de passe en session ou celui fournit par le formulaire. Encodé en MD5 à ce moment là ou pas ? $utilisateur->offsetSet('taux_horaire', $personnel->getTauxHoraire()); $utilisateur->offsetSet('date_modif', $personnel->getDateCreationModification()); // $utilisateur->offsetSet('fonction',$personnel->getRefFonction()->getIntituleFonction()); $utilisateur->offsetSet('connecte', true); }
public function miseEnSessionUtilisateur(Personnel $personnel, $email, $motDePasse) { $utilisateur = new Container('utilisateur'); $utilisateur->offsetSet('id', $personnel->getId()); $utilisateur->offsetSet('admin', $personnel->getAdministrateur()); $utilisateur->offsetSet('identite', $personnel->getPrenom() . ' ' . $personnel->getNom()); $utilisateur->offsetSet('email', $email); $utilisateur->offsetSet('mot_de_passe', $motDePasse); $utilisateur->offsetSet('taux_horaire', $personnel->getTauxHoraire()); $utilisateur->offsetSet('date_modif', $personnel->getDateCreationModification()); // $utilisateur->offsetSet('fonction',$personnel->getRefFonction()->getIntituleFonction()); $utilisateur->offsetSet('connecte', true); }
/** * {@inheritDoc} */ public function getPrenom() { $this->__initializer__ && $this->__initializer__->__invoke($this, 'getPrenom', array()); return parent::getPrenom(); }